예제 #1
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_increment_decrement_command(self)
예제 #2
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or) -> str:
     return visitor.visit_program(self)
예제 #3
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_write_command(self)
예제 #4
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_jump_command(self)
예제 #5
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_array_declaration(self)
예제 #6
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_read_command(self)
예제 #7
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_if_then_command(self)
예제 #8
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_array_element_by_variable_identifier(self)
예제 #9
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_commands(self)
예제 #10
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_assignment_command(self)
예제 #11
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_two_value_condition(self)
예제 #12
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_expression_having_two_values(self)
예제 #13
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_declarations(self)
예제 #14
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_identifier_value(self)
예제 #15
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_do_while_command(self)
예제 #16
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_variable_identifier(self)
예제 #17
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_int_number_value(self)
예제 #18
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_array_element_by_int_number_identifier(self)
예제 #19
0
파일: AST.py 프로젝트: KamilKrol5/compiler
 def accept(self, visitor: Visitor):
     return visitor.visit_number_declaration(self)